comScore: Russia has most engaged social audience

comscore.jpgHere are the details:

• 74% of the Russian online population is in the social space (34.5 million consumers)
• On average, Russians spend 9.8 hours in the social space per month
• Facebook is the 5th most popular social network (4.5 million visitors) in the country, following sites such as Vkontakte.ru (27 million visitors) and Odnoklassniki (16.7 million visitors)
• Social hub Vkontakte was the 4th most visited site overall, behind Yandex, DST and Google sites

“It is very exciting to watch the developments of the continuously strong-growing Russian internet market, where many Russian-based companies still outnumber global players,” said Mike Read, SVP & managing director, comScore Europe. “The substantial growth in the Russian social media sector provides a sizeable advertising opportunity and reflects the importance of online connectivity for the Russian population.”

For total visitors, only the UK has most consumers visiting social websites (35.7 million UK visitors versus 34.5 million Russian visitors). Canada and Turkey also have high numbers of consumers (more than 20 million each) visiting social networks.

As far as time spent with social networks, Isreal is Russia’s closest competitor with visitors spending 9.2 hours per month compared to 9.8 hours per month (Russia). Consumers in Turkey and the UK spend just over 7 hours per month social networking and then consumers in the Philippines (5.1 million) come into the picture, spending an average of 6.2 hours per month on socnets.
